      Description of problem:

      Currently, our document states that we should set 4GB swap on all compute nodes:
      Note: Controller node doesn't have this sentence.

       

      https://access.redhat.com/documentation/en-us/red_hat_openstack_platform/17.1/html-single/installing_and_managing_red_hat_openstack_platform_with_director/index#ref_compute-node-requirements_planning-your-overcloud
      Configure at least 4 GB of swap space.
      

      However, Director doesn't configure swap on overcloud nodes by default.

       

      <from my RHOSP 17.1 lab>
      [root@central-novacompute-0 ~]# swapon
      [root@central-novacompute-0 ~]# free -h
                     total        used        free      shared  buff/cache   available
      Mem:            24Gi       1.3Gi        23Gi        12Mi       573Mi        23Gi
      Swap:             0B          0B          0B
      

      Do we really need swap for overcloud nodes?
      If swap is needed, I suppose Director should configure swap by default, or at least our document should have some instructions to configure swap.

      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
      RHOSP 17.1

      How reproducible:
      Steps to Reproduce:
      1. Deploy RHOSP 17.1 normaly

      Actual results:
      Swap is not configured on overcloud nodes.

      Expected results:
      Swap is configured on overcloud nodes.
      (Or should we remove "Configure at least 4 GB of swap space" sentence from our documentation?)
